This is the much-awaited ebook release of Iwan Roberts' best-selling diary of Norwich City's 2003/2004 season. Brutally honest, revealing and at times hilariously funny, All I Want for Christmas... was acclaimed by the critics and was heralded as an instant classic by City fans and lovers of great football books.

All I Want For Christmas... was also highly controversial, with Iwan being charged by the FA over a section of the book in which he admitted stamping on an opponent in revenge for an earlier tackle. In September 2005 he was subsequently fined £2,500 and banned for three matches.
Time has moved on from the success-filled season covered in the book but it has stood the test of time and Iwan's genuine humour and self-effacing personality still reveal the striker's love of the club and the game.
